On a practical level, start your search for a Perry mortgage broker by asking for referrals from your local real estate agent, friends, or family who have recently purchased in Lake County. Look for brokers who are deeply familiar with Ohio-specific programs. For instance, the Ohio Housing Finance Agency (OHFA) offers fantastic benefits for eligible buyers, including competitive interest rates, down payment assistance, and grants. A knowledgeable broker will guide you through OHFA’s options, like the Your Choice! Down Payment Assistance program, which can provide 2.5% or 5% of the loan amount to help with your upfront costs. They can determine if you meet income and purchase price limits, which are especially relevant for first-time homebuyers looking in Perry.
Your action plan should begin with interviews. Contact two or three brokers in the area. Ask them: How do you communicate with clients? Can you provide examples of loans you’ve secured for buyers in Perry? What Ohio-specific programs do you recommend for my situation? Pay attention to how they explain complex terms; your broker should be your educator and advocate.
Remember, a broker’s service is typically paid by the lender, but their true value is in shopping for you. They can scour their network for the best rate and term combination that fits your financial picture, whether you’re a veteran exploring a VA loan, a professional using a physician loan, or a family utilizing a conventional loan.
